This instrument repeals seven legislative instruments which concern relief related to product disclosure statements, superannuation dashboards and Financial Services Guides, and four further legislative instruments that are redundant.

ASIC Corporations (Repeal) Instrument 2022/499

I, Jane Eccleston, delegate of the Australian Securities and Investments Commission, make the following legislative instrument.

 

Date    9 June  2022

 

 

Jane Eccleston

 



Part 1—Preliminary

1        Name of legislative instrument

This is the ASIC Corporations (Repeal) Instrument 2022/499.

2        Commencement

This instrument commences on the later of:

(a)     the day after it is registered on the Federal Register of Legislation; and

(b)     the date of its gazettal.

Note:    The register may be accessed at www.legislation.gov.au.

3        Authority

This instrument is made under paragraphs 911A(2)(l), 926A(2)(c) and 951B(1)(c) and subsections 741(1), 992B(1) and 1020F(1) of the Corporations Act 2001.

4        Schedules

Each instrument that is specified in a Schedule to this instrument is amended or repealed as set out in the applicable items in the Schedule concerned, and any other item in a Schedule to this instrument has effect according to its terms.

5        Repeal of amending and repealing instruments

(1)     The repeal of an instrument by section 4 does not affect any amendment to or repeal of another instrument (however described) made by the instrument.

(2)     Subsection (1) does not limit the effect of section 7 of the Acts Interpretation Act 1901 as it applies to the repeal of an instrument by section 4 of this instrument.
